Introduction

Silly string is a popular party accessory known for its vibrant colors and playful nature. While it adds excitement to celebrations, many people wonder, does silly string stain clothes? The answer is yes, it can stain if not addressed quickly. Silly string is made from a combination of polymers and dyes, which can adhere to fabric fibers. To minimize the risk of staining, consider the following tips:
  • Act quickly: The sooner you treat the stain, the better your chances of removal.
  • Blot, don’t rub: Gently blot the area with a clean cloth to absorb excess string.
  • Use cold water: Rinse the stained area with cold water to help lift the dye.
  • Check fabric care labels: Always refer to the care instructions for your clothing.

FAQs

How can I remove silly string stains from clothing?

To remove silly string stains, act quickly by blotting the area with a clean cloth, then rinse with cold water. You may also use a stain remover or laundry detergent as per fabric care instructions.

Does silly string stain all types of fabric?

Silly string can stain many types of fabric, but some materials are more susceptible than others. Delicate fabrics like silk may be more prone to staining compared to cotton.

What should I do if silly string dries on my clothes?

If silly string has dried, gently scrape off any excess, then treat the stain with cold water and a stain remover before washing the garment as per care instructions.

Can silly string stains be removed after washing?

It can be more challenging to remove silly string stains after washing, as heat can set the stain. However, re-treating the stain with cold water and a stain remover may help.

Is there a way to prevent silly string stains?

To prevent silly string stains, use it in outdoor settings or cover clothing with a protective layer. Acting quickly to clean any spills also helps minimize staining risk.
